How the Machine Buried Spencer Pratt

 Spencer Pratt's campaign for mayor in Los Angeles seemed promising but ultimately fell victim to the entrenched political system of California. Despite an engaging campaign and early leads on Election Day, Pratt found himself losing ground rapidly due to the state's electoral dynamics.

1. Initial Momentum:

• Spencer Pratt used innovative advertising strategies that resonated with voters, leveraging AI to create impactful campaign videos that highlighted the problems in Los Angeles.

• His campaign gained traction, with early voting results showing Pratt leading his competitors, including Karen Bass, the incumbent, and Nithya Raman.

2. Political Machine Dynamics:

• Bill de Blasio criticized Pratt's campaign, despite his controversial track record as a mayor. This reflects a broader political environment where established politicians benefit from continuing issues in urban areas.

• Pratt's campaign offered hope for change, yet the established political system in California acted to ensure that Pratt did not secure a place on the November ballot.

3. Election Day Outcomes:

• On Election Day, early results showed Pratt leading, but his position quickly eroded as more votes were counted.

• By the end of the week following the election, Pratt found himself trailing Raman by a significant margin—this was attributed not merely to voter fraud but to the informed operations of California’s election laws utilized by his opponents.

4. Structural Challenges:

• California's election system includes numerous factors that complicate fair ballot counting, such as long early voting periods, mail-in ballots, and opportunities for voter harvesting.

• The political machine relies on groups with strong ground games who can effectively mobilize and harvest votes from specific demographics. This process diminishes the impact of well-run campaigns like Pratt's.

5. Conclusion of The Campaign:

• Despite his strong start, Pratt's campaign could not overcome the extensive resources and strategies employed by his opponents, highlighting a systemic issue within California's electoral landscape.

• The campaign's outcome indicates a troubling trend for Republican candidates in California, who often face significant disadvantages against a well-organized political establishment.

Spencer Pratt's mayoral bid, marked by innovative strategies and initial support, ultimately succumbed to the complexities of California’s political machine, leaving little room for change and showcasing the challenges faced by candidates attempting to disrupt the status quo.
